Guest Stealth Ranger

Hi Bill

 

Well the kit is the Italeri kit 244 the post WW2 version back dated

 

Eduard photo etch brass

 

Friul metal tracks

 

Formations turret and wheels ( the hull and track guards were rubbish) so I altered the kits to match the Formations one

 

The stores are a mixture of Blast models, Verlinden and Tamiya

 

.50 cal is a Tasca with an Armour Scale barrel

 

.30cal is Armour Scale

 

Figure is Verlinden

 

The 75mm is I think The Barrel Store
